The goodness of college can be measured on a number of parameters, the most important being the placements. The placements of AIET are somewhat average and could be said as a little below average. Startup companies are most common here. Moreover the overall rating of this college is approximately 5.7/10, which is not that much appreciated as other RTU affiliated colleges.
